Turns out, this is not actually a Mac port at all. It's a Windows version runing in an emulator (Wine). So I'm pretty sure the problem lies there, eg. perhaps it's using a version of Wine that isn't supported anymore.

To fix this error you must:
1. Install Moroshka File Manager from App Store (free)
2. Check "Show Hidden Files" in preferences
3. Go to the /Users/YOUR_USER_NAME/Library/Application Support and delete Grand Theft Auto - San Andreas folder.
